Hello,

I've to write an application which requires a secured communication channel. To keep the user's effort minimal I want to use pre-shared keys for authentication. Now my question: In my understanding when using PSK-DH the client is authenticated when connecting to the server, but is the server also authenticated against the client? Or in other words: When an attacker replaces the server by his own implementation is the client able to recognize this? Or do I have to use a server certificate to achieve this.
